Output 21d2b68a1867dd81e955ddb9a53f88ca076fdbe5ca68d8d01ce651608143436c:5

value
8874739
script pubkey
OP_0 OP_PUSHBYTES_20 f6f34ab34ae70fd4b6f7f038528377c5ea01e390
address
ltc1q7me54v62uu8afdhh7qu99qmhch4qrcuszn9rps
transaction
21d2b68a1867dd81e955ddb9a53f88ca076fdbe5ca68d8d01ce651608143436c
spent
true